    摘要: Systems and methods for generating and controlling generation of ammonia. The ammonia generation control system includes a communication module and an ammonia generation module coupled to the communication module. The ammonia generation module is configured to cause generation of gaseous ammonia from a solid ammonia source in response to a determination that an ammonia storage quantity in an ammonia dosing storage cartridge meets a first pre-determined threshold and a determination that an engine condition of an internal combustion engine coupled to ammonia dosing storage cartridge meets a pre-determined engine condition threshold.

    摘要: An ammonia flow modulator having a housing, a fluid passage, a first valve, preferably having a precision orifice, positioned within the passage, and an orientation which prevents fluid from pooling in the passage is disclosed and claimed. As an added feature, the device may include a heat source positioned within the housing proximate at least one of a fluid inlet, a fluid outlet, and the fluid passage. The heat source may be provided by an electric heating element, an exhaust gas heat exchanger, or any other suitable source. As econd inlet and a second passage fluidly connecting the second inlet to the outlet by fluidly linking the second passage to the first passage and including a check valve to prevent backflow. A controller coupled to the first valve is used to control ammonia flow.

    摘要: Methods for generating and applying coatings to filters with porous material in order to reduce large pressure drop increases as material accumulates in a filter, as well as the filter exhibiting reduced and/or more uniform pressure drop. The filter can be a diesel particulate trap for removing particulate matter such as soot from the exhaust of a diesel engine. Porous material such as ash is loaded on the surface of the substrate or filter walls, such as by coating, depositing, distributing or layering the porous material along the channel walls of the filter in an amount effective for minimizing or preventing depth filtration during use of the filter. Efficient filtration at acceptable flow rates is achieved.

    摘要: An ammonia generating and delivery apparatus generating ammonia by heating a precursor material with a heating device controlled by a temperature pulse controller which receives commands from a pressure controller, and delivering ammonia with a flow rate controlled by a three-stage PWM controller. The temperature pulse controller is used in a first feedback loop to create a temperature pulse sequence at a surface of the heating device. A pressure controller in a second feedback loop provides duty-cycle commands to the temperature pulse controller, while in delivering ammonia, effects of pressure variation to delivery accuracy are compensated in the three-stage PWM controller, which includes a flow-rate feedback loop. The ammonia generating and delivery apparatus can also include two containers, in which the precursor material in one container is charged and discharged according to the capability of the other container in generating ammonia.

    摘要: The present invention relates to a technology of reducing nitrogen oxide (NOx) which is harmful discharge gas discharged from an internal combustion engine or a combustor, and to an exhaust gas purification system which inputs solid ammonium salt such as ammonium carbamate or ammonium carbonate into a reactor, thermally decomposes and converts the solid ammonium salt into the ammonia by using engine cooling water, exhaust gas, or an electric heater, which are installed in the reactor, and reduces the nitrogen oxide included in the exhaust pipe on a selective catalytic reduction into nitrogen by injecting the ammonia by using a pressure regulator and a dosing valve.

    摘要: A solid SCR system includes solid state reductant, a container storing the solid state reductant, an exhaust pipe supplying gas state reductant converted from the solid state reductant and SCR catalyst disposed on the exhaust pipe, an exhaust heat recovery device disposed on the exhaust pipe and recovering waste heat from exhaust gas exhausted through the exhaust pipe and a heat exchanger connected to the exhaust heat recovery device and supplying the recovered heat to the solid state reductant.
